When considering rhinoplasty, or a nose job, in Canton, Ohio, it’s essential to grasp the financial implications involved. The cost of this procedure can vary significantly based on several factors, including the surgeon’s expertise, the complexity of the surgery, and the facility where the operation is performed. On average, you might find that rhinoplasty in this region can range from $5,000 to $15,000.
This price range typically includes the surgeon’s fee, anesthesia costs, and facility fees, but it’s crucial to inquire about what is specifically included in the quoted price. Moreover, understanding the costs associated with rhinoplasty goes beyond just the initial price tag. You should also consider potential additional expenses such as pre-operative consultations, post-operative follow-up visits, and any necessary medications for pain management or infection prevention.
By being aware of these factors, you can better prepare your budget and avoid any unexpected financial burdens after your surgery.

Factors that Influence the Cost of Rhinoplasty
Several factors can influence the overall cost of rhinoplasty in Canton, Ohio. One of the most significant determinants is the complexity of your specific case. If you require extensive reshaping or correction of structural issues, the procedure may take longer and necessitate more advanced techniques, which can increase costs.
Additionally, if you are seeking a revision rhinoplasty—an operation to correct or improve results from a previous surgery—the costs may be higher due to the intricacies involved. Another critical factor is the surgeon’s experience and reputation. Highly skilled and board-certified plastic surgeons often charge more for their services due to their extensive training and proven track record of successful outcomes.
While it may be tempting to choose a less expensive option, remember that investing in a qualified surgeon can lead to better results and minimize the risk of complications. Furthermore, the location of the surgical facility can also impact costs; facilities in more affluent areas may have higher fees compared to those in less populated regions.

What to Expect During the Rhinoplasty Procedure
On the day of your rhinoplasty procedure, you will likely arrive at the surgical facility early for pre-operative preparations. After checking in, you will meet with your surgical team who will review your medical history and answer any last-minute questions you may have. Once everything is confirmed, you will be taken into the operating room where anesthesia will be administered.
The actual procedure can vary depending on whether you’re undergoing open or closed rhinoplasty techniques. In general, it involves making incisions either inside the nostrils or across the columella (the tissue between your nostrils) to access the underlying structures of your nose. The surgeon will then reshape bone and cartilage as needed before closing up incisions with sutures.
The entire process typically lasts between one to three hours, after which you’ll be moved to a recovery area where medical staff will monitor you as you wake up from anesthesia.
Postoperative Care and Recovery After Rhinoplasty in Canton Ohio
After your rhinoplasty procedure in Canton, Ohio, proper postoperative care is crucial for achieving optimal results. You will likely experience some swelling and bruising around your nose and eyes; this is normal and should gradually subside over time. Your surgeon will provide specific instructions on how to care for your nose during recovery, including how to manage any discomfort with prescribed medications.
It’s essential to follow these guidelines closely; avoid strenuous activities or heavy lifting for at least a few weeks post-surgery as this can increase swelling or lead to complications. You may also need to attend follow-up appointments so your surgeon can monitor your healing progress and address any concerns that arise during recovery. Remember that patience is key; while initial results may be visible within weeks, it can take several months for swelling to fully resolve and for your final results to emerge.

Does insurance cover the cost of rhinoplasty?
In most cases, rhinoplasty is considered a cosmetic procedure and is not covered by insurance. However, if the procedure is being done for functional reasons, such as to correct a deviated septum or improve breathing, some insurance plans may provide coverage.
